Police Rescue 2 Kidnap Victims In Zamfara

No fewer than two abducted persons have been reportedly rescued after a Search and rescue operation by the Zamfara State police command.

The command said their rescue followed an operation at Dumburum and Gidan Jaja forest in Zurmi Local Government Area (LGA), of the state.

In a statement signed by its spokesperson, Muhammed Shehu, the command said the duo were abducted 19 days ago at the Magami district of K/Namoda LGA.

“The victims were rescued unconditionally during an extensive search and rescue operations”, Shehu said, noting that the rescued persons had undergone medical treatment and had been debriefed by the Police.

On his part, the Commissioner of Police, Ayuba Elkanah, said “will continue to work assiduously to ensure the unconditional rescue of all kidnapped victims across the state”.

Elkanah further called on members of the public to continue to support the security operatives in the ongoing operations against bandits and other criminal elements in the State.
